With glorious serendipity the relaunched Rabbit In The Moon – already a five star ToM fave – has just chosen to open for lunch on Friday and Saturday.
The £45 lunchtime tasting menu features favourite dishes from the set dinner menu – the likes of prawn cracker ‘Rabbit Ears’ with nam-tok and dashi, Scottish langoustine and sesame toast with hot and sour beef soup, hand dived scallop in XO sauce, soy and ginger glazed pork cheek and crispy beef in black bean sauce with nasi goreng (pictured).
Boo! Reading the small print it promises business lunchers can be out within the hour. ToM promises to work in a little overtime.
Rabbit In The Moon, Urbis Building, Corporation Street, Manchester, M4 3BG. 0161 804 8560. Open for lunch, Friday and Saturday, 12pm-2pm. Booking required.
